V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
xpa
V2EX  ›  程序员

阿里的 OSS 文档好乱

  •  
  •   xpa · 15 天前 · 3487 次点击
    感觉阿里的 OSS 文档好乱,只是想后端 Java 签名,前端通过直传并设置回调

    结果回调接口的 callbackBody 能传递哪些参数都没找到,各种文档乱七八糟的。。。


    官方说明:OSS 发送给应用服务器的内容。如果是文件,可以是文件的名称、大小、类型等。如果是图片,可以是图片的高度、宽度等。
    官方示例:filename=${object}&size=${size}&mimeType=${mimeType}&height=${imageInfo.height}&width=${imageInfo.width}

    但是我根本不知道还有哪些额外参数,参数名叫什么也没说

    真离谱。。。
    36 条回复    2024-07-05 00:09:52 +08:00
    ssgooglg
        1
    ssgooglg  
       15 天前
    之前用阿里的 oss 就是因为文档问题弃用了
    xpa
        2
    xpa  
    OP
       15 天前
    @ssgooglg 感觉很坑,但又感觉那么多人用肯定有原因
    gaobh
        3
    gaobh  
       15 天前 via iPhone
    用 s3 标准接口不行么
    vkillwucy
        4
    vkillwucy  
       15 天前 via Android   ❤️ 1
    抄的 s3,最早还看到 aws 字眼
    TomyJan
        5
    TomyJan  
       15 天前
    要不试试去看支持 oss 的开源项目的代码, 比如 lskypro 什么的
    xxfye
        6
    xxfye  
       15 天前 via Android
    不知道你看的是 oss 自己的协议,还是 s3 协议。
    我只能说就是 s3 垃圾而已,aws 一层层往 s3 上添加各种 feature ,使得 s3 已经成为一个巨大的屎山了。
    weijancc
        7
    weijancc  
       15 天前
    用 s3 标准接口就好了
    sayitagain
        8
    sayitagain  
       15 天前
    真的乱,而且还有不同版本
    ocsp
        9
    ocsp  
       15 天前   ❤️ 3
    那你是没看过科大讯飞的文档
    crz
        10
    crz  
       15 天前
    @xpa #2 用的人多两种原因

    1. 先行者,事实标准
    2. 大集团,有资源推广,也能给到做好的资源

    3. 不坑的评价是多方面的,每个项目都可能有所侧重有所舍弃
    vituralfuture
        11
    vituralfuture  
       14 天前 via Android
    同样接入过阿里云的一个 API ,方法是 get 还是 post 不说,如果是 post ,content type 也没说,参数正确的也一直报错,最后我去看 SDK 源码,调试一次后才发现 SDK 用的是 post ,然后 version 这个字段不能是最新的,文档里也没说
    watzds
        13
    watzds  
       14 天前
    coderzhangsan
        14
    coderzhangsan  
       14 天前
    世界是个草台班子
    songunity
        15
    songunity  
       14 天前
    这种可以问问 AI
    DiamondYuan
        16
    DiamondYuan  
       14 天前 via Android
    @vituralfuture

    这种一般都是网关统一转发,不遵守 restful 协议,只是把 http 当成通信信道。
    humbass
        17
    humbass  
       14 天前
    正经的用法就是签名+授权上传,简单的很,更安全点用 STS
    llej
        18
    llej  
       14 天前
    使用它的新版 api 控制台可以自动生成对应代码,还行
    lwg
        19
    lwg  
       14 天前
    可以直接提工单,帮你找资料
    whosyourdaddy94
        20
    whosyourdaddy94  
       14 天前
    是的直接提供单会有专人对接解决的,老哥反馈的这个问题后续我会记录反馈下同事。
    neptuno
        21
    neptuno  
       14 天前 via iPhone
    我之前是直接调用 java sdk ,预上传,获取临时的 put 地址,返回给前端,前端上传一下就好了。
    xpa
        22
    xpa  
    OP
       14 天前
    @watzds 就是这个,找了大半天,感谢
    xierqii
        23
    xierqii  
       14 天前   ❤️ 1
    那你是没看我们内部文档和线上实际功能。千差万别。。
    dbak
        24
    dbak  
       14 天前
    阿里云的 sdk 文档很坑 sdk 更新了好几版了 线上的文档还是老的 连接口名都换了 你只能去看它的 sdk 包的内容才行
    289396212
        25
    289396212  
       14 天前
    阿里的技术真的不行
    Seanfuck
        26
    Seanfuck  
       14 天前
    他们的云后台也是,做得跟 ppt 一样,一堆没用的东西,进入一个功能要点很多没用的页面
    wqhui
        27
    wqhui  
       14 天前
    阿里文档算好了,最起码还能找人工客服问,遇到过好几次参数名都对不上,而且几个入口看同一个 api 会有轻微差异,估计是文档没有及时更新。微信的文档对不上都没地方问
    justfindu
        28
    justfindu  
       14 天前
    那么些个云服务中, 阿里的文档已经算这里面好的了. 加上有个 OpenApi 开发者门户, 有个调试页面, 自动代码.
    ltux
        29
    ltux  
       14 天前
    国内公司的产品,有哪个文档写得好的
    yuheCai
        30
    yuheCai  
       14 天前   ❤️ 1
    微信小程序文档:?
    yulgang
        31
    yulgang  
       14 天前
    其他厂商联通、电信也一个屌样 ,都差不多
    aladd
        32
    aladd  
       14 天前
    你没见过 ucloud 的~哇哦!
    VampireDemon
        33
    VampireDemon  
       14 天前
    微信的公众号服务器配置接口才日龙,验证有时是 get,有时是 post
    Dawnnnnnn
        34
    Dawnnnnnn  
       14 天前
    昨天刚喷了一次阿里云,一个服务不声不响的迭代升级把接口参数改了,我翻了半天文档也没看到那个参数改成啥了,提了工单客服告诉我这个参数没了,要用更麻烦的方法来重新实现这个参数的功能。真是麻了,阿里云的版本管理真是垃圾啊
    wxyoung
        35
    wxyoung  
       14 天前
    问通义千问,我好多 oss 问题都是问他得到的答案
    AlienHH
        36
    AlienHH  
       13 天前 via iPhone
    维护文档是一个老难的工作了
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   3596 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 33ms · UTC 10:23 · PVG 18:23 · LAX 03:23 · JFK 06:23
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.